Founded by the Romans around AD 50, London has evolved from a small settlement along the River Thames into England’s famous capital city.

Today, London is known for its iconic landmarks, theatre and arts, and some of the world’s top museums and galleries. 

The restaurant scene is diverse and vibrant, offering a wide range of culinary experiences to residents and visitors alike. The city boasts a mix of modern restaurants, trendy markets and global cuisine with authentic dishes from every corner of the world, reflecting London’s rich culinary heritage. From Michelin-starred fine dining to cosy British pubs there is something to suit every taste and budget.

Foodies can explore popular food markets such as Borough Market or Camden Market, showcasing a range of delicious options from around the globe. London also hosts a variety of food festivals throughout the year, featuring everything from street food to gourmet dishes.  

Each area of London has its own distinct personality and charm. For example, Soho is famous for its trendy restaurants with a mix of modern sophistication and bohemian flair. It is also home to Chinatown, with a range of authentic Asian eateries. Covent Garden is a lively area, perfect for shopping, dining and heading to the theatre, with the Royal Opera House and West End theatres nearby. Over in east London, Shoreditch is known for its trendy bars and pop-up eateries, with a hip, artistic vibe.

Many restaurants pride themselves on offering fresh, seasonal dishes that showcase the best of the region's culinary offerings. Whether you're craving traditional British fare, exotic flavours, or innovative fusion cuisine, London's restaurant scene has something for everyone to enjoy.
